The problem is that your post appears to be a spam posting, i.e. a blanket posting spread generically around the internet not concerned with conversation, but merely drawing traffic to your site. The appearance of you being the owner or operator of the site being the username having similarity to the topic of the thread and the organization name. Add to that blue text, which is typically used on the internet to indicate links. Complicated by the fact that these are not links.

Thus the response of many posters that you were probably “trolling”, i.e. posting to stir up trouble rather than actually interested in discussion. Aiding that assessment is your response to people by calling them juvenile and demanding an apology.
